SPATA31 subfamily C member 2 (SPATA31C2) is a protein-coding gene, most highly expressed in testis and sperm, and predicted to play a role in spermatogenesis and cell differentiation. The protein may be an integral membrane component, but its precise function is currently unclear. Although sometimes previously annotated as a possible pseudogene, current evidence from genome resources and proteomics supports a protein-coding role. There is no evidence of a direct role in disease or in drug interactions and it is not considered a therapeutic target. The wider SPATA31 family is conserved across mammals, with some paralogs suggested to participate in DNA repair and response to UV damage in other contexts.
